Output 8bfa77f99f6f0ebfc17cd6665bba03a106b15078dc93225ef3301987f2352d4a:1

value
15731854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5082cf5e570384fd5ab4c674c127ec2523640d OP_EQUAL
address
MHbJJmKX7tekuzJD6HXXzcEt51Q3vPyLBY
transaction
8bfa77f99f6f0ebfc17cd6665bba03a106b15078dc93225ef3301987f2352d4a
spent
true